On this day in 1804 – March 8th – American astronomer and telescope maker Alvan Clark was born in Ashfield, Massachusetts.
In 1846 he founded Alvan Clark & Sons, which made astronomical telescopes and instruments. Notably, the company made the lenses for large refracting telescopes at Lick Observatory and Yerkes Observatory.
